I am a 57 year old owner of a business consulting business - we have rented several properties in the Cary area over the years - this was by far the worst experience I have ever had with any company. I have never written a review, but feel that any potential renters who are considering working with Block - reconsider - renter beware!
I have no interest in calling out anyone at Block - I just want potential renters to really consider carefully working with this company. I can't speak to how well they take care of the owners who they represent, but they fall way short when it comes to the tenant - I would never consider working with them again and would recommend against it to anyone who asked me what I thought.
We signed a two year lease through Block of a "high-end" house in the Cary area - the problems started early - before we moved in, Block called me at 9 p.m. - left a message ( I was out of town on an engagement) and said that they would be there at 8 a.m. the next morning - I could join them for a walk-through - my impression was that this was a strategy to make sure I most likely wouldn't make it. After moving in there were several issues that needed resolving - that lead to a 12 month back-and-forth of HUNDREDS of e-mails, which I have filed away - this was almost a full-time job in itself. After 12 months, I stopped the communication.
For a relatively small company, Block is setup such that you have no single contact - I probably dealt with six different people - if you want to have a relationship with your property management company forget about it - there is no interest - this is the kind of company structure I go in and fix.
You can imagine that as a company owner and someone who has been in the customer service business all of my life, this was frustrating. Whenever there was something wrong, I felt I was guilty until proven innocent and even accused of it one time - by someone who was most likely half my age! I deal with CEO's, Presidents and other C-Level execs on a daily basis - at Block I was a second class citizen.
Don't get me wrong - there were people at Block who tried to help - at the end of the day it didn't change my experience.
The final insult was a strategy (my opinion) by Block to withhold as much of the initial deposit as could be obtained by really stretching the bounds of rationality. I was docked almost $1,000.00 because Block Accused my dog of "biting the cabinets" - have you ever heard of a dog that bites cabinets? If you do decide to work with Block - make sure you write-off your deposit.
